Say whether True or false
  1. Setting of curd is a chemical change
  2. Burning of wood and cutting it into small pieces are two different types of changes
  3. Blowing of a balloon is fast irreversible change
  4. Chopping of vegetables is reversible physical change
  5. Switching on of the fans is a reversible physical change

1) Settling of curd is a chemical change . True. The original substance is milk and a new substance is formed .ie. curd . Curd is different from the milk and hence is a chemical change.

2) Burning of wood and cutting it into small pieces are both physical and chemical changes. True

Burning of wood and cutting of wood into small pieces are two very different processes. While burning of wood is both a physical and chemical change, the cutting of wood into small pieces only a physical process.  

Wood is basically carbon. So when wood is burnt, the carbon combines with the oxygen present in the air and is converted to carbon dioxide. Also, the unburnt carbon is converted into a black mass. This process also leads to the emission of smoke. Thus we can see that burning of wood is involving the formation of new chemical substances. Also, the overall shape and appearance of wood changes. So it is classified as both a physical and a chemical change. 

On the other hand, cutting of wood into smaller pieces is only a physical process. No chemical  change is taking place as no new chemical substance is being formed. Here only the size of wood is changing. So it is a physical change. 

3) Blowing of balloon is a irreversible change. False . Blowing of balloon is a reversible change . When air is blown into the balloon , its shape and size changes and when air is released from the balloon , it will come back to its original shape . 

4) Chopping of vegetables is irreversible and physical change. The cutting of vegetable is a physical change as shape has been changed and also it cannot be reversed back. 

5) Switching on of the fan is a reversible physical change as it will repeat its motion after a fixed interval of time.
